In preparing for our Baltic cruise, I’ve been doing a lot of research about various aspects of our trip.  One thing I’ve learned is that the Copenhagen airport is notorious for losing baggage.  So… that brings me to my travel tip this Tuesday evening for you – when flying with someone else and you really need your stuff, you need to cross pack.

Haven’t heard of cross packing?  It’s just putting half your stuff and half your traveling companion’s stuff in one bag and the rest in another bag.  Further, make sure that you REALLY cross pack.  That means that, if you’re packing 2 bags, put half your undies, half your tops, half your dresses, etc. in one bag and the other half in the other bag.
